According to Oxford Dictionary (via Google), point blank means “very close”. This would be the layman’s definition.
The official definition (per Wikipedia) is close enough to not have to compensate for the effects of gravity on the bullet when aiming.
So no, it’s not “within lethal range”.
It means the target is close enough that you don’t need to adjust for drop, you can just point and shoot
